Hi there. I recently upgraded from a lumia 1320 to the new lumia 950 however this phone requires a charge twice over a 12 hour period(i use my phone moderately throughout the day). The 1320(3400mAh) gave me 2-3 days baterry life with a single charge, i have expected the 950(3000mAh) to give me atleast a day and a half due to the new software and the 1440p screen but thats not the case i lost 40% battery in 5 hours while on standby. Please note that the phone is only 4 days old and i have read other forums that suggested i do a reset of the device which i have done to no avail. On a full charge battery saver says it will last 16 hours after the reset it stated one day and 17 hours, short while later(78%) it stated that it will last only 17 hours. I really love the 950 and its awesome features but this battery is kiling me. Especially when theres a sony xperia m5 that lasts 2 days on a single charge. Nokia/ Microsoft phones were built on great Camera's, awesome sound quality and thee never ending battery life. i would be please if i can get through an entire day of use and still have 40% left over at the end of the day.

Hey Rob. i manage to sort mine out although it still runs warm under charge but other than that its almost pefect. its using 40% a day thats with an entire day(12 hours) of use. all you need to do is reset your device, make sure you back-up your information, thereafter remove your memory card. go into settings-> system->storage, scroll down to save location and ensure that for downloads "This Device" is selected. then go to update & security and check for updates. update .29 should be available. after installing the update then you have one awesome windows phone to get to discover.
